“…Whereas the isoelectric point of bovine brain mME is 6.9 (authors' unpublished data), a zero net charge was fciund on cME at pH 6.2 in this study. This value compares well with isoelectric points of 6.3 and 6.15 determined for the cytosolic enzymes isolated from rat liver (Wada et al, 1975) and rat skeletal muscle (Swierczyhski, 1980), respectively. The different molecular masses and isoelectric points of cME and mME are further indications of structural differences of the two ME isozymes from bovine brain.…”
